Bidirectional quantum teleportation in continuous variables

E. A. Nesterova, S. B. Korolev

Published 2024-08-12Version 1

We propose a bidirectional quantum teleportation protocol in continuous variables. We use a cluster state in continuous variables as the main resource to realize this protocol. In the paper, we obtain a family of configurations of cluster states in continuous variables that can be used to realize the bidirectional quantum teleportation protocol. From the whole family of configurations, we have chosen those that realize the protocol with the smallest possible error.
